Practical Tips for Embroidery Designers

If you're planning to use Romeo and Juliet Font in your seasonal collection, here are a few tips to ensure success:

  1. Test Thread Colors: Always test different thread colors on both light and dark fabrics to ensure the final result looks as intended.
  2. Check Stitch Density: Ensure that the stitch density is appropriate for the fabric type and the size of the design.
  3. Confirm Hoop Size: Choose the right hoop size based on the complexity of the design to avoid issues with clarity and detail.
  4. Use Proper Stabilizer: A good stabilizer is essential for maintaining fabric integrity, especially with intricate designs like this one.
  5. Create Realistic Mockups: Before selling, create printable mockups to give customers a clear idea of how the final product will look.
  6. Review Small Details: After stitching, inspect the design closely for any minor issues that may affect the overall appearance.
  7. Plan Color Palettes: Think about how the font will complement other elements in your product line, such as background patterns or coordinating accessories.
  8. Check Licensing: Always review Creative Fabrica product details and licensing terms before selling finished seasonal products.
